Arweave AO是一个基于Arweave区块链的分布式、去中心化、面向Actor(Actor Oriented)的计算系统。AO旨在通过超并行计算技术和去中心化存储,为高并发、分布式、容错性强的系统提供解决方案。
Actor模型是计算机科学中一种并发计算模型的基本单位。在Actor模型中,每个Actor可以修改其分配的私有状态,但如果要修改其他Actor的状态,只能通过发送消息间接修改。这种方法适合构建高并发、分布式、容错性强的系统,也是AO项目命名的原因。
AO由三个核心单元组成:
通信单元负责消息通信,将消息传递给计算单元并协调以计算输出结果。它确保了各个计算单元之间的高效通信和数据传输。
调度单元负责调度和消息排序,并将消息上传至Arweave。它管理消息的传递顺序和优先级,确保系统内各个单元的协调运作。
计算单元负责处理计算任务,并将计算结果上传至Arweave。它是系统的核心处理器,执行各种计算任务并生成结果数据。
AO通过区块链的编排,每个单元都可以作为可水平扩展的子网,同时执行大量交易,从而实现高性能运算。理论上,AO可以提供近乎无限的计算性能,满足各种高计算需求的应用场景。
AO的核心目标是在没有任何实际规模限制的情况下,实现无需信任和协作的计算服务。通过这种方式,AO为应用程序提供了结合区块链的全新范式,确保数据和计算结果的安全性和可靠性。
相比其他高性能区块链,如Solana、Aptos和Sui,AO可以支持存储大量数据,例如AI模型。这为数据密集型应用提供了强大的支持,特别是在AI和大数据分析领域。
AO允许任意数量的并行进程同时运作于计算单元中,并通过开放的消息传递与其他单元协作。不同于以太坊只能使用单个共享内存空间,AO不依赖于中心化内存空间,极大地提高了系统的并行处理能力和灵活性。
AO代币将实行100%公平发行,计划总量为2100万枚。代币通过跨链至AO、持有AR或建设来铸造,确保代币分配的公平性和透明度。
AO代币将在四年内逐步减半,类似于比特币的发行机制。这种设计旨在控制代币的通货膨胀率,激励早期参与者,同时确保长期的价值增长。
虽然AO具备高度创新性,但其技术实现面临诸多挑战:
复杂性:构建一个高效的Actor模型并确保各单元的无缝协作需要复杂的编排和管理。
性能优化:确保高并发和分布式系统的性能优化是一个持续的技术挑战,需要不断的改进和优化。
尽管AO技术先进,但市场接受度和用户教育也是一个关键问题。Arweave团队需要通过积极的市场推广和社区教育,提高潜在用户和开发者对AO的理解和接受度。
Arweave团队将继续致力于技术创新,进一步优化AO的性能和功能。此外,随着越来越多的开发者和企业加入Arweave生态系统,AO的应用场景和生态系统将不断扩展,推动区块链和AI技术的共同发展。
全球数据存储和计算需求的快速增长,为AO提供了广阔的市场机会。AO通过结合超并行计算和去中心化存储,能够满足这一市场需求,具有广阔的应用前景。
Arweave将积极寻求与AI和区块链领域领先企业的合作,共同推动技术进步和市场应用。通过行业合作,AO有望在更广泛的领域中得到应用,促进区块链和AI技术的普及和发展。